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0482539 01353569 334264
40456206980 4707637973 0344901
40456206980 4707637973 0344901
617460 6190 3116
All about undefined
Interested in learning more?
40456206980 4707637973 0344901
617460 6190 3116
See more
388 2247 9470793655
0250 13865627 43
See more
64410 91618 8900
5988 00848 77
See more